Subject: [PATCH 00/13] Pass data temperature information to zoned UFS devices
Date: Wed, 20 Sep 2023 12:14:25 -0700 [thread overview]
Message-ID: <20230920191442.3701673-1-bvanassche@acm.org> (raw)
Hi Jens,
Zoned UFS vendors need the data temperature information. Hence this patch
series that restores write hint information in F2FS and in the block layer.
The SCSI disk (sd) driver is modified such that it passes write hint
information to SCSI devices via the GROUP NUMBER field.
